发明名称 一种用于租赁豆浆机的加密方法
摘要 本发明公开了一种用于租赁豆浆机的加密方法,包括如下步骤:a提供上位机、U盘和用于租赁的目标豆浆机,上位机具有写入U盘、密码保护及密码授权功能,目标豆浆机的控制器包括CPU、USB接口、人机操作界面、存储器等;U盘作为上位机与目标豆浆控制器的CPU之间的传输媒介;b首先由上位机将用户信息以加密文件的形式写入U盘,由承租户将U盘插入豆浆机的USB接口,目标豆浆机控制器的CPU读取U盘中的加密文件后,进行解密得到包括租赁条件在内的新用户信息,CPU根据新用户信息控制目标豆浆机,当目标豆浆机一旦出现不能满足租赁条件的情形时就终止工作。本发明方便实用,能够有效地保障制造商/经销商的权益。
申请公布号 CN102610039B 申请公布日期 2014.04.02
申请号 CN201210061523.8 申请日期 2012.03.12
申请人 山东科技大学 发明人 黄鹤松;薛琳;范士帅;杨闳竣;刘奎;魏兰磊;刘朝;任程程
分类号 G07F17/00(2006.01)I;A47J31/00(2006.01)I;A23C11/10(2006.01)I 主分类号 G07F17/00(2006.01)I
代理机构 济南舜源专利事务所有限公司 37205 代理人 王连君
主权项 一种用于租赁豆浆机的加密方法,其特征在于包括如下步骤:a提供上位机、U盘和用于租赁的目标豆浆机;上位机能够完成用户信息的编辑、查找、添加、删除以及更新用户信息,同时具有写入U盘、密码保护及密码授权功能;目标豆浆机的控制器包括CPU和第二USB接口;U盘作为上位机与目标豆浆机控制器的CPU之间的传输媒介;b首先将U盘插入上位机的第一USB接口,由上位机将用户信息以加密文件的形式写入U盘;然后将U盘交付给豆浆机承租户,由豆浆机承租户将U盘插入第二USB接口,CPU借助于第二USB接口读取U盘中的加密文件,CPU获取加密文件后,进行解密得到包括租赁条件在内的新用户信息,租赁条件包括针对目标豆浆机所设定的租期和/或使用次数,CPU根据新用户信息控制目标豆浆机,当目标豆浆机一旦出现不能满足上述租赁条件的情形时就终止工作;所述步骤b中,上位机采用异或运算加密和随机数相结合的加密方式,将0‑9中的每个数字都与一个字符相对应,利用随机数的不规律性,将有效信息以一定顺序嵌套在随机数中形成信息序列,并将该信息序列按照上面的映射函数翻译成相应的字符;所述步骤b中,在将U盘插入第二USB接口时,按一下控制器人机界面上的相应按键,CPU即开始读取U盘中的加密文件,CPU获取加密文件后,将其中的用户信息存入存储器内,待存储完毕后控制器上的相应指示灯会亮起,此时拔下U盘操作即告完成;CPU在目标豆浆机运行时实时判断目前的操作是否满足租赁条件,如果满足租赁条件,目标豆浆机能够正常工作,反之则终止工作。
地址 266590 山东省青岛市经济技术开发区前湾港路579号